Is a repeating decimal a rational number? Explain. (Answer choices are in the picture)

Every repeating decimal is a rational nuber.

A rational number is a number that can be written as the fraction of two integers, with the denominator not being 0.

0.333333... = 1/3

0.555555... = 5/9

0.27272727.... = 3/11
